So I was looking at the new Master Ironsmith and I'm wondering if he might actually allow for some pretty wild stuff.
His ability is worded as such:
Response: After you play Master Ironsmith from your hand, if you paid all of its resource cost from a single hero's resource pool, attach a Weapon or Armor attachment from your hand or discard pile to that hero without paying its resource cost.
When you use his ability are you actually "playing" the attachment?
The FAQ states:
The “Attach to...” rules text on an attachment is only a play restriction, and is not taken into account after the card is already attached.
So is the attachment already attached by the time the restriction text would normally be taken into account? Does this mean that I could play something like Elven Spear or even Sword of Morthond on Tactics Boromir if he paid for the Ironsmith?
